Scope and content
Papers (case, answer, briefs, a translation of the Haverfordwest charter of 1609/1610, etc.) in two actions in Chancery by Hugh Fowler of the town and county of Haverfordwest, esq., 1721, and by James Cousins, in ejectment on the demise of Hugh Fowler, 1724, against the mayor, sheriff, bailiffs, and burgesses of Haverfordwest and John Perry, water bailiff of the same, defendants, touching the right of profits of an extension of the quay at Haverfordwest alleged to have been erected on part of ground in the possession of Hugh Fowler.
